In this paper biological sequences are modelled by stationary ergodic sequences. A new family of statistical tests to characterize the randomness of the inputs is proposed and analyzed. Tests for independence and for the determination of the appropriate order of a Markov chain are constructed with the Chaos Game Representation (CGR), and applied to several genomes.
